diff --git a/pom.xml b/pom.xml
index febe178..65ddd18 100644
--- a/pom.xml
+++ b/pom.xml
@@ -42,6 +42,11 @@
client-runtime
1.6.15
+
+ com.microsoft.azure
+ azure
+ 1.32.1
+
io.reactivex
rxjava
diff --git a/samples/java/com/microsoft/bing/samples/BingAutosuggestV7.java b/samples/java/com/microsoft/bing/samples/BingAutosuggest.java
similarity index 100%
rename from samples/java/com/microsoft/bing/samples/BingAutosuggestV7.java
rename to samples/java/com/microsoft/bing/samples/BingAutosuggest.java
diff --git a/samples/java/com/microsoft/bing/samples/BingCustomSearchV7.java b/samples/java/com/microsoft/bing/samples/BingCustomSearch.java
similarity index 100%
rename from samples/java/com/microsoft/bing/samples/BingCustomSearchV7.java
rename to samples/java/com/microsoft/bing/samples/BingCustomSearch.java
diff --git a/samples/java/com/microsoft/bing/samples/BingEntitySearchV7.java b/samples/java/com/microsoft/bing/samples/BingEntitySearch.java
similarity index 100%
rename from samples/java/com/microsoft/bing/samples/BingEntitySearchV7.java
rename to samples/java/com/microsoft/bing/samples/BingEntitySearch.java
diff --git a/samples/java/com/microsoft/bing/samples/BingImageSearchV7.java b/samples/java/com/microsoft/bing/samples/BingImageSearch.java
similarity index 100%
rename from samples/java/com/microsoft/bing/samples/BingImageSearchV7.java
rename to samples/java/com/microsoft/bing/samples/BingImageSearch.java
diff --git a/samples/java/com/microsoft/bing/samples/BingImageSearchV7Quickstart.java b/samples/java/com/microsoft/bing/samples/BingImageSearchV7Quickstart.java
index 10726c2..e30f2ba 100644
--- a/samples/java/com/microsoft/bing/samples/BingImageSearchV7Quickstart.java
+++ b/samples/java/com/microsoft/bing/samples/BingImageSearchV7Quickstart.java
@@ -117,13 +117,4 @@ public class BingImageSearchv7Quickstart {
}
}
}
-
-// Container class for search results encapsulates relevant headers and JSON data
-class SearchResults{
- HashMap relevantHeaders;
- String jsonResponse;
- SearchResults(HashMap headers, String json) {
- relevantHeaders = headers;
- jsonResponse = json;
- }
}
\ No newline at end of file
diff --git a/samples/java/com/microsoft/bing/samples/BingNewsSearchV7.java b/samples/java/com/microsoft/bing/samples/BingNewsSearch.java
similarity index 100%
rename from samples/java/com/microsoft/bing/samples/BingNewsSearchV7.java
rename to samples/java/com/microsoft/bing/samples/BingNewsSearch.java
diff --git a/samples/java/com/microsoft/bing/samples/BingSpellCheckV7.java b/samples/java/com/microsoft/bing/samples/BingSpellCheck.java
similarity index 100%
rename from samples/java/com/microsoft/bing/samples/BingSpellCheckV7.java
rename to samples/java/com/microsoft/bing/samples/BingSpellCheck.java
diff --git a/samples/java/com/microsoft/bing/samples/BingVideoSearchV7.java b/samples/java/com/microsoft/bing/samples/BingVideoSearch.java
similarity index 100%
rename from samples/java/com/microsoft/bing/samples/BingVideoSearchV7.java
rename to samples/java/com/microsoft/bing/samples/BingVideoSearch.java
diff --git a/samples/java/com/microsoft/bing/samples/BingVisualSearchV7.java b/samples/java/com/microsoft/bing/samples/BingVisualSearch.java
similarity index 100%
rename from samples/java/com/microsoft/bing/samples/BingVisualSearchV7.java
rename to samples/java/com/microsoft/bing/samples/BingVisualSearch.java
diff --git a/samples/java/com/microsoft/bing/samples/BingWebSearchV7.java b/samples/java/com/microsoft/bing/samples/BingWebSearch.java
similarity index 100%
rename from samples/java/com/microsoft/bing/samples/BingWebSearchV7.java
rename to samples/java/com/microsoft/bing/samples/BingWebSearch.java